At Dr Sknn, we take advantage of the Lynton Lumina, a state-of-the-art Intense Pulsed Light System (IPL) used by the NHS and private medical centres across the UK, to treat Morgan De Campbell Spots in a secure and effective manner on skin types I-IV. By delivering light in certain wavelength ranges at Dr Sknn, we can target absorption peaks in haemoglobin and oxy-haemoglobin, permitting us to treat Morgan De Campbell Spots of various sizes and depths without causing any damage to the surrounding skin. After the therapy, the affected vessels are reabsorbed by the body and scarcely any trace of the original lesion stays.

At Dr Sknn, IPL is used to make the most of light energy, by causing the Morgan De Campbell Spots to heat up to a particular point where they spasm and/or contract, thus sealing them. In the succeeding weeks, the wrecked Morgan De Campbell Spots are naturally absorbed by the body, leaving little to no trace of the original lesion.
